摘要
This paper deals with studies on the optical resolution of glycyl-DL-amino acid dipeptides and diastereomeric dipeptides on three different chemically bonded chiral ligand exchange chromatography (LEC)-phases. The phases were prepared by binding L-proline or L-hydroxyproline to silica gel using different silanes as spacer. Using 10(-5) M copper(II) sulfate as a mobile phase, eleven glycyl-dipeptides were resolved, nearly all of them with baseline separations. Several dipeptides containing two stereogenic centres were at least partially resolved into the four stereoisomers.
